versōrĭa (vors- ), ae, f. verto,
I.a rope that guides a sail, a sheet (Plautin.); hence, trop.: versoriam capere, to turn the sail, i. e. tack: “cape vorsoriam, Recipe te ad erum,about ship! Plaut. Trin. 4, 3, 19: “cape modo vorsoriam,id. Merc. 5, 2, 34.
